- <!-- Note: A "Server" is not itself a "Container", so you may not
- define subcomponents such as "Valves" at this level.
- Documentation at /docs/config/server.html
- -->
- <Server port="8005" shutdown="SHUTDOWN">
- <!-- Security listener. Documentation at /docs/config/listeners.html
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.security.SecurityListener" />
- -->
- <!--APR library loader. Documentation at /docs/apr.html -->
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.core.AprLifecycleListener" SSLEngine="on" />
- <!--Initialize Jasper prior to webapps are loaded. Documentation at /docs/jasper-howto.html -->
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.core.JasperListener" />
- <!-- Prevent memory leaks due to use of particular java/javax APIs-->
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.core.JreMemoryLeakPreventionListener" />
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.mbeans.GlobalResourcesLifecycleListener" />
- <Listener className="org.apache.catalina.core.ThreadLocalLeakPreventionListener" />
- <!-- Global JNDI resources
- Documentation at /docs/jndi-resources-howto.html
- -->
- <GlobalNamingResources>
- <!-- Editable user database that can also be used by
- UserDatabaseRealm to authenticate users
- -->
- <Resource name="UserDatabase" auth="Container"
- type="org.apache.catalina.UserDatabase"
- description="User database that can be updated and saved"
- factory="org.apache.catalina.users.MemoryUserDatabaseFactory"
- pathname="conf/tomcat-users.xml" />
- </GlobalNamingResources>
- <!-- A "Service" is a collection of one or more "Connectors" that share
- a single "Container" Note: A "Service" is not itself a "Container",
- so you may not define subcomponents such as "Valves" at this level.
- Documentation at /docs/config/service.html
- -->
- <Service name="Catalina">
- <!--The connectors can use a shared executor, you can define one or more named thread pools-->
- <!--
- <Executor name="tomcatThreadPool" namePrefix="catalina-exec-"
- maxThreads="150" minSpareThreads="4"/>
- -->
- <!-- A "Connector" represents an endpoint by which requests are received
- and responses are returned. Documentation at :
- Java HTTP Connector: /docs/config/http.html (blocking & non-blocking)
- Java AJP Connector: /docs/config/ajp.html
- APR (HTTP/AJP) Connector: /docs/apr.html
- Define a non-SSL HTTP/1.1 Connector on port 9090
- -->
- <Connector port="9090" protocol="HTTP/1.1"
- connectionTimeout="20000"
- redirectPort="8443" />
- <!-- A "Connector" using the shared thread pool-->
- <!--
- <Connector executor="tomcatThreadPool"
- port="9090" protocol="HTTP/1.1"
- connectionTimeout="20000"
- redirectPort="8443" />
- -->
- <!-- Define a SSL HTTP/1.1 Connector on port 8443
- This connector uses the JSSE configuration, when using APR, the
- connector should be using the OpenSSL style configuration
- described in the APR documentation -->
- <!--
- <Connector port="8443" protocol="HTTP/1.1" SSLEnabled="true"
- maxThreads="150" scheme="https" secure="true"
- clientAuth="false" sslProtocol="TLS" />
- -->
- <!-- Define an AJP 1.3 Connector on port 8009 -->
- <Connector port="8009" protocol="AJP/1.3" redirectPort="8443" />
- <!-- An Engine represents the entry point (within Catalina) that processes
- every request. The Engine implementation for Tomcat stand alone
- analyzes the HTTP headers included with the request, and passes them
- on to the appropriate Host (virtual host).
- Documentation at /docs/config/engine.html -->
- <!-- You should set jvmRoute to support load-balancing via AJP ie :
- <Engine name="Catalina" defaultHost="localhost" jvmRoute="jvm1">
- -->
- <!-- channelSendOptions="6" in order to replicate sessions synchrounously -->
- <Engine name="Catalina" defaultHost="localhost">
- <Cluster className="org.apache.catalina.ha.tcp.SimpleTcpCluster"
- channelSendOptions="6">
- <Manager className="org.apache.catalina.ha.session.DeltaManager"
- expireSessionsOnShutdown="false"
- notifyListenersOnReplication="true"/>
- <Channel className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.group.GroupChannel">
- <Membership className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.membership.McastService"
- address="228.0.0.6"
- port="45564"
- frequency="500"
- dropTime="3000"/>
- <Receiver className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.transport.nio.NioReceiver"
- address="auto"
- port="4000"
- autoBind="100"
- selectorTimeout="5000"
- maxThreads="6"/>
- <Sender className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.transport.ReplicationTransmitter">
- <Transport className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.transport.nio.PooledParallelSender"/>
- </Sender>
- <Interceptor className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.group.interceptors.TcpFailureDetector"/>
- <Interceptor className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.group.interceptors.MessageDispatch15Interceptor"/>
- <Interceptor className="org.apache.catalina.tribes.group.interceptors.ThroughputInterceptor"/>
- </Channel>
- <Valve className="org.apache.catalina.ha.tcp.ReplicationValve"
- filter=".*\.gif;.*\.js;.*\.jpg;.*\.htm;.*\.html;.*\.txt;" />
- <Valve className="org.apache.catalina.ha.session.JvmRouteBinderValve"/>
- <ClusterListener className="org.apache.catalina.ha.session.JvmRouteSessionIDBinderListener"/>
- <ClusterListener className="org.apache.catalina.ha.session.ClusterSessionListener"/>
- </Cluster>
- <Realm className="org.apache.catalina.realm.UserDatabaseRealm"
- resourceName="UserDatabase"/>
- <Host name="localhost" appBase="webapps"
- unpackWARs="true" autoDeploy="false"
- xmlValidation="false" xmlNamespaceAware="false">
- <Valve className="org.apache.catalina.valves.AccessLogValve" directory="logs"
- prefix="localhost_access." suffix=".log"
- pattern="%h %l %u %t "%r" %s %b "%{Referer}i" "%{User-Agent}i" "%S""
- resolveHosts="false" />
- </Host>
- </Engine>
- </Service>
- </Server>
